Manzanillo's Peninsulas de Santiago neighborhood is known for its beaches and entertainment, and entices visitors with attractions including Playa La Audiencia and Playa la Boquita.
If being by the water is a major draw, Playa La Audiencia is a spot you might want to check out, located 4.2 mi (6.8 km) from central Manzanillo. If you want to continue walking by the waves, head to Playa Olas Altas located nearby.
When the beach is calling your name, you might want to head down to Playa la Boquita, located 6.5 mi (10.5 km) from central Manzanillo. Enjoy the sunset by the shore at Playa Miramar, Playa Olas Altas, and Playa La Audiencia.
Whether you want to collect beach glass or watch the sunset, Playa Miramar is a spot you might want to check out, located 6.3 mi (10.2 km) from central Manzanillo. Enjoy the sunset by the shore at Playa la Boquita, Playa Olas Altas, and Playa La Audiencia.
If being by the water is a major draw, Playa San Pedrito is a spot you might want to check out, located 0.8 mi (1.3 km) from central Manzanillo. If you want to continue walking by the waves, head to Playa La Audiencia and Playa Azul Salagua.
Whether you want to hunt for sand dollars or smell the fresh air, Oro Beach is a spot you might want to check out, located 12.6 mi (20.3 km) from central Manzanillo. Enjoy the sunset by the shore at Playa Peña Blanca.
Malecón de Manzanillo is worth a pic or two when discovering El Centro. Why not take a stroll along the beaches and watch the sunset while you're here?
Whether you want to collect beach glass or watch the sunset, Playa Olas Altas is a spot you might want to check out, located 5.2 mi (8.4 km) from central Manzanillo. If you want to continue walking by the waves, head to Playa La Audiencia located nearby.
You might want to play some rounds at Las Hadas Golf Course, located 4.1 mi (6.6 km) from central Manzanillo. Why not take a stroll along the beaches and watch the sunset while you're here? If Las Hadas Golf Course doesn't quite scratch your golfing itch, El Corazón de Manzanillo Golf Course is just a short drive away.
Admired for its entertainment and seaside, Manzanillo features attractions such as Playa San Pedrito and Playa La Audiencia. Visitors to this beachside city speak highly of the seafood restaurants whereas sights include Playa Olas Altas and Playa Miramar.
